Battle Ruleset
Super Sneak
Up to Eleven
Stampede
Mana Cap 38

  • Super Sneak rule means all Melee attack Monsters have the Sneak ability.
  • Up to Eleven rule means all Monsters have the Amplify ability.
  • Stampede rule means The Trample ability can trigger multiple times per attack if the trampled Monster is killed.

Sneak Ability : Targets the last Monster on the enemy Team instead of the first Monster.
Amplify Ability : Increases Magic Reflect, Return Fire, and Thorns damage to all enemy monsters by 1.

My Strategy

First of all in this battle I should to put a monster in the last position that could evade Melee Attacks, I believed that Regal Peryton, who has the flying ability and is quite speed, could help me. But when I thought Regal Peryton would be the target of 5 monsters each round, she might not be able to deal with these attacks, so I put a Monster with the Martyr Ability right next to her. When the Monster with the Martyr Ability was destroyed, her stats would increase by +1, which meant that her speed and attack power would increase by +1. Thinking that it would be advantageous to put a Monster with the Camouflage Ability in the last position, I decided to put Djinn Biljka with the Camouflage Ability in the last position. Djinn Biljka with the Camouflage Ability would not be the target of attacks when he was in the back line. I also added Clockwork Aide with the Swiftness Ability to my team, thinking that adding a Monster with the Swiftness Ability would strengthen my strategy. Thanks to Clockwork Aide, the speed of all monsters on my team would increase by +1. And finally, I decided to put monsters with high health in the top two positions in my team. Frankly, I believed that with this strategy, I would have a better chance of winning this rather tough battle, and I decided to build my team with this strategy and adjusted the line-up of the monsters as follows.

LINE UP

Summoner : OBSIDIAN

In this battle, I planned to destroy the enemies with Magic Attack Monsters and chose Obsidian as the Summoner so that they could attack targets more powerfully. Obsidian is a Summoner that gives +1 Magic Attack to all friendly Magic Attack Monsters.

Position 1: TERRACEOUS GRUNT

Terraceous Grunt is a Monster in the Earth Unit that can attack the target with Melee Attacks. Terraceous Grunt has 2 Melee Attacks, 2 Speed, 11 Health, and the Dodge Ability at level 4. The main reason I chose Terraceous Grunt in this battle was that it has 11 health and Dodge Ability, so I put it in the first position on the team. I thought Terraceous Grunt would give the team an advantage if it could evade a few attacks. By the way Terraceous Grunt costs 6 mana and has 11 health, which I think is a huge advantage.

  • Dodge Ability : Has an increased chance of evading Melee or Ranged attacks.

Position 2: RUNEMANCER FLORRE

Runemancer Florre is a very powerful Monster in the Earth Unit that can attack the target with both Magic Attacks and Ranged Attacks. Runemancer Florre has 2 Magic Attacks, 2 Ranged Attacks, 4 Speed, 13 Health at level 4. The main reason I chose Runemancer Florre in this battle was because she has 13 health, and I put her in second position on the team.

Putting monsters with high health in the top two positions was part of my strategy.

Position 3: CLOCKWORK AIDE

Clockwork Aide is a Monster in a Neutral Unit with no attack power. Clockwork Aide has 8 armor, 1 Health, and the Swiftness Ability at level 2. I thought increasing the speed of the monsters on my team in this battle would give my team a huge advantage, so I added Clockwork Aide with the Swiftness Ability to my team and put it in the third position. Thanks to Clockwork Aide, the speed of all monsters on my team will increase by +1. Also, Clockwork Aide's 8 armor would have been an advantage, as I thought all monsters on the opposing team would be Melee Attackers.

  • Swiftness Ability : All friendly Monsters have increased Speed.

Position 4: REGAL PERYTON

Regal Peryton is a pretty fast Monster in the Earth Unit that can attack the target with Magic Attacks. Regal Peryton has 2 Magic Attacks, 6 Speed, 5 Health, and the Flying Ability at level 2. The most important reason why I chose Regal Peryton in this battle is that she is speedy and has the Flying Ability. Also, thanks to Clockwork Aide, Regal Peryton would have 7 speed in this battle. And after the Fungus Flinger was destroyed, she would have 8 speed. I thought that Melee Attack Monsters on the opposing team would have a hard time dealing damage to Regal Peryton in this battle, so I put her in fourth position.

  • Flying Ability : Has an increased chance of evading Melee or Ranged attacks from Monsters who do not have the Flying ability.

Position 5: FUNGUS FLINGER

Fungus Flinger is a Monster in the Earth Unit that can attack the target with a Ranged Attack. Fungus Flinger has 1 Ranged Attack, 2 Speed, 4 Health, and the Martyr Ability at level 4. The most important reason I added Fungus Flinger to my team in this battle was because it had the Martyr Ability. I knew the Fungus Flinger would be destroyed very quickly, which was already part of my strategy. That's why I put it in the fifth position. When Fungus Flinger is destroyed because it has the Martyr Ability, adjacent Monsters get +1 to all stats. So, increasing Regal Peryton's and Djinn Biljka's stats by +1 was an important part of my strategy to win this battle. So the sooner the Fungus Flinger was destroyed, the better it would be for my strategy.

  • Martyr Ability : When this Monster dies, adjacent Monsters get +1 to all stats.

Position 6: DJINN BILJKA

Djinn Biljka is a Monster in the Earth Unit that can attack the target with Magic Attacks. Djinn Biljka has 2 Magic Attacks, 1 Speed, 2 Health, and the Camouflage Ability and Void Ability at level 2. While Djinn Biljka only has 1 speed and 2 health is a huge disadvantage, having the Camouflage Ability is a huge advantage. Because he has the Camouflage Ability, he is not directly targeted by enemies while in the backline. But monsters with Blast and Scattershot Ability can ruin my whole strategy, so I hope there won't be Monsters with Blast and Scattershot Ability on the opposing team. The survival of Djinn Biljka until the end of the battele in this battele was very important for me to win the battele. I trusted him very much in his powerful attacks. I put Djinn Biljka in the last position.

  • Camouflage Ability : This Monster cannot be directly targeted for attacks unless it's in the first position.
  • Void Ability : Reduced damage from Magic attacks.

BATTLE COMMENTS

Round 1

battle24032023.png
Battle Link

To be honest, the opposing player's strategy was flawless according to the rulesets of the battle. Indeed, the opposing team was very, very powerful compared to my deck. It was impossible for me to defeat such a team with Melee Attack and Ranged Attack Monsters. That's why I was wise to opt for Magic Attack Monsters.

In the first round, my team performed great by attacking the opposing team powerfully. and Fungus Flinger was easily destroyed in the first two attacks of enemies, this was already part of my strategy. Djinn Biljka and Regal Peryton's stats increased by +1 after Fungus Flinger was destroyed. Regal Peryton was unable to evade the first attack, but managed to evade the next two attacks.

Round 2

round2.png

While my team was attacking the opposing team powerfully, the opposing team had a very difficult time inflicting damage on Regal Peryton. In the second round, Regal Peryton gave a great performance by evading 4 attacks. But she could not evade an attack.

Round 3

round3.png

In the third round, the opposing team managed to destroy Regal Peryton, but it was too late for the opposing team. In the third round, 3 monsters from the opposing team were destroyed, while in my team only Regal Peryton was destroyed. Things were not going well for the opposing team, but my strategy was working pretty well.

Round 4

round4.png

I can honestly say I'm very surprised that Terraceous Grunt is still alive and has 6 health. Also, Djinn Biljka's very powerful and brutal attacks were truly admirable and helped a lot in destroying enemies. In the fourth round, there were 2 monsters left on the opposing team but Ever-Hungry Skull had only 1 health so it wasn't hard to destroy it. But since Cursed Windeku has the Heal Ability, it wouldn't be easy to destroy it. In such a battle, Terraceous Grunt was unlikely to survive against Cursed Windeku, so Cursed Windeku easily destroyed it.

Round 5

round5.png

In the fifth round, only Cursed Windeku was alive on the opposing team and it was also destroyed in the first two attacks. Honestly, I didn't expect to win this battle that easily, really my strategy worked pretty well and I still had 3 monsters alive on my team.

round52.png

The battle lasted only 5 rounds, my strategy worked quite well in this battle although the opposing team was very powerful, and while all the monsters in the opposing team were destroyed, 3 monsters were still alive in my team. This battle clearly shows how important it is to strategize according to the opposing team in battles.
